How to Design and Order Your Own Custom Men’s Ring

Designing your own custom men’s ring is like playing dress-up for your finger – but way cooler and without the childhood nostalgia. Start by picturing the perfect band that screams “that’s me!” without yelling it too loudly. Think about metals like sleek gold or tough titanium, and don’t forget to jazz it up with engravings or gemstones that add a personal twist, all while imagining how it’ll make your hand look like a boss-level accessory. Once you’ve sketched out your dream ring on paper or via an online designer tool, it’s time to hit up a reputable jeweler who won’t judge your wild ideas – they’ve seen it all, from subtle bands to ones that could double as a secret weapon.

To seal the deal on ordering, follow these straightforward steps in a process that’s as easy as sliding on a ring (fingers crossed it fits first try):

  • Step 1: Upload your design specs to the jeweler’s site, ensuring you specify size and materials to avoid any “oops, that’s too snug” mishaps.
  • Step 2: Review proofs and make tweaks – it’s your chance to play ring referee before committing.
  • Step 3: Place the order and wait patiently, because good things (like a custom ring) take time, and you don’t want to rush a masterpiece that’ll live on your finger forever.
